Understanding Mesothelioma & Asbestos Exposure
What is Mesothelioma?
Mesothelioma is a rare form of cancer that affects the protective lining of the lungs (pleura), abdomen (peritoneum), or heart (pericardium). The primary cause of mesothelioma is long-term exposure to asbestos, a naturally occurring mineral that was widely used in the 20th century for its durability and heat resistance. Unfortunately, it is now known to be a carcinogen that, when inhaled or ingested, can cause serious health issues, including mesothelioma.
How Asbestos Exposure Occurs
Asbestos exposure usually happens in the following ways:
- Occupational Exposure: People working in industries like construction, shipbuilding, manufacturing, and power plants were often exposed to asbestos as part of their daily jobs. Asbestos was commonly used in materials like insulation, fireproofing, and pipes.
- Home Exposure: Older homes and buildings may contain asbestos in materials like flooring, insulation, and roofing. Renovations or damage to these materials can release asbestos fibers into the air.
- Secondhand Exposure: Family members of workers who handled asbestos were also at risk. Asbestos fibers could be carried home on clothing, tools, or equipment, exposing loved ones to the danger.
Why Mesothelioma Is Hard to Diagnose
Mesothelioma has a long latency period, meaning that symptoms may not appear until 20 to 50 years after exposure to asbestos. This makes early diagnosis difficult, and symptoms often resemble those of other illnesses, delaying treatment and complicating the process of seeking compensation.

Steps to Filing a Mesothelioma Claim
Gathering Evidence
To build a strong mesothelioma case, it’s important to gather as much evidence as possible:
- Medical Records: Your diagnosis from a specialist is crucial. A mesothelioma diagnosis must be confirmed by a medical professional before pursuing a claim.
- Exposure History: You will need to provide proof of your exposure to asbestos. This could include records of where you worked, the types of materials you handled, or where you lived.
- Witness Statements: Testimonies from coworkers, family members, or others who may have witnessed your exposure to asbestos can also support your case.
Filing a Lawsuit or Trust Fund Claim
Once you have gathered all necessary evidence, your lawyer will help you file either:
- A lawsuit against the responsible parties
- A claim to asbestos trust funds, which can provide quicker compensation without the need for a lawsuit
Each claim is subject to a statute of limitations, meaning you must act within a certain period after being diagnosed. In North Carolina, this time frame is usually limited to three years for personal injury claims.
Compensation & Settlement Expectations
Types of Compensation Available
Victims of mesothelioma can pursue various types of compensation:
- Medical Expenses: This includes treatment costs, surgeries, chemotherapy, and other necessary care.
- Lost Wages: If mesothelioma has prevented you from working, you may be entitled to compensation for the wages you have lost.
- Pain and Suffering: Mesothelioma is a painful disease, and you can seek compensation for the physical and emotional suffering you have endured.
Average Mesothelioma Settlements
While settlements vary depending on the specifics of the case, mesothelioma lawsuits often result in substantial payouts. On average, settlements range from $1 million to $2.4 million. The amount depends on factors such as the severity of the illness, the extent of asbestos exposure, and the skill of the lawyer handling the case.
